The Witcher 3 Remastered on Steam Deck: What to Expect

The Witcher 3 Remastered Steam Deck experience is one of the most discussed topics among handheld RPG fans, and for good reason. The next-gen update brought ray tracing and DX12 rendering that push the Deck's AMD APU harder than the classic build ever did. The good news: with the right renderer choice and settings, the game remains one of the best-looking RPGs you can play on a handheld.

Real-world reports from Steam Deck owners paint a consistent picture. On an OLED Deck, high settings with strong visuals deliver a solid 30 FPS, while a mix of medium and high settings makes 40-45 FPS achievable. Players who prefer the classic 1.32 version can force the DX11 backend, which uses the older, lighter renderer and reduces stress on the hardware considerably.

Pro Tip

If your priority is frame rate and battery life over ray tracing, switch the game to the DX11 backend in the launcher settings. It uses the classic renderer and dramatically reduces the load on the Steam Deck's APU.

Best Settings for Steam Deck Performance

Choosing the right settings is the difference between a stuttery slideshow and a smooth hunt through Velen. The table below summarizes the three most popular configurations based on community testing.

ProfileRendererSettings MixTarget FPSBattery (OLED)
Visual QualityDX12High30 FPS~2-2.5 hours
BalancedDX11Medium/High mix40-45 FPS~3 hours
EnduranceDX11Medium, 30 FPS cap30 FPS locked3+ hours

Key settings recommendations:

  • Resolution: Keep the native 1280x800; avoid FSR upscaling artifacts by using FSR Quality only if needed
  • Ray tracing: Off — the performance cost on Deck far outweighs the visual gain
  • Foliage distance: Medium — one of the biggest performance levers in outdoor areas
  • Shadows: Medium — high shadows cost frames with minimal visual payoff at 7 inches
  • Frame cap: 40 or 45 FPS matches the Deck's refresh options well and smooths out frame pacing
Watch Out

Avoid maxing out DX12 with ray tracing on Steam Deck. Frame rates drop well below 30 FPS in dense areas like Novigrad, and battery drain increases sharply for minimal visual benefit on a 7-inch screen.

Step-by-Step: Optimizing The Witcher 3 Remastered on Your Deck

Follow this sequence to get the best balance of visuals, frame rate, and battery life. Each step builds on the previous one, so apply them in order.

1

Select the Right Renderer

Launch the game and choose the DX11 backend in the version selector. This uses the classic renderer, which is far lighter on the Deck's APU than DX12.

2

Apply the Balanced Preset

Set graphics to a medium/high mix. Prioritize medium foliage distance and shadows, keep textures high since VRAM impact is manageable.

3

Cap the Frame Rate

Set a 40 or 45 FPS cap in the Steam Deck quick settings menu (QAM). A locked frame rate feels smoother than an unstable higher one.

4

Limit TDP and Refresh Rate

Set the TDP limit to around 10-12W and match the display refresh rate to your FPS cap (40 Hz for 40 FPS). This is the single biggest battery saver.

5

Undervolt (Advanced, OLED)

On OLED models, a mild undervolt of roughly -50mV across CPU/GPU offsets reduces heat and extends play sessions to around 3 hours.

Expected Result

With this configuration, most players report a stable 40-45 FPS in open-world areas with occasional dips to the high 30s in dense towns, plus roughly 3 hours of battery life on the OLED model.

Battery Life: LCD vs OLED Steam Deck

Battery life is where the OLED model pulls ahead of the original LCD Deck. The OLED's more efficient display panel and newer silicon translate directly into longer Witcher 3 sessions.

ModelBattery CapacityRuntime (Stock)Runtime (Optimized)
Steam Deck LCD40Wh~90 minutes~2 hours with TDP tuning
Steam Deck OLED50Wh~2.5 hours~3 hours with 10-12W TDP + undervolt

LCD owners can still squeeze out around two hours by lowering the TDP limit and capping frames at 30-40 FPS, but the OLED is clearly the better pick for long Witcher 3 sessions on the go.

FAQ

Q: Can the Steam Deck run The Witcher 3 Remastered at 60 FPS?

A locked 60 FPS is not realistic on Steam Deck with the next-gen version. With the DX11 renderer and lowered settings, some lighter indoor areas may approach 60, but open-world gameplay typically settles at 40-45 FPS with a medium/high mix.

Q: Is the classic version 1.32 better on Steam Deck than the next-gen update?

For pure performance and battery life, yes. The classic build uses the lighter DX11 renderer, which reduces stress on the APU. Players who value frame rate and playtime over ray tracing often prefer it. You can also simply force the DX11 backend on the current version for a similar effect.

Q: How long does the battery last playing The Witcher 3 Remastered on Steam Deck?

On the OLED model with a 10-12W TDP limit and mild undervolting, expect around 3 hours. The LCD model manages roughly 90 minutes at stock settings, extendable to about 2 hours with tuning.

Q: Should I enable ray tracing on Steam Deck?

No. Ray tracing pushes frame rates well below 30 FPS on the Deck's hardware and drains battery faster, while the visual difference on a 7-inch 800p screen is minimal. Keep it disabled for the best experience.
